That is exactly what happened when a Dairy Queen franchise in Wisconsin became the focus of public attention after displaying a sign describing the restaurant as "politically incorrect." While many customers viewed the message as a statement about free expression and traditional values, others criticized it as unnecessary, divisive, or unwelcoming.
The resulting debate spread rapidly across social media platforms, news websites, and online forums, where thousands of people weighed in with differing opinions. Despite criticism and calls for the sign to be removed, the restaurant owner chose not to apologize, maintaining that the message reflected the values of the business and its community.
